|
SCHEDULE OF FINANCIAL ASSETS MEASURED AT FAIR VALUE ON A RECURRING BASIS (Details) - USD ($)
|
Mar. 31, 2022
|
Dec. 31, 2021
|Impairment Effects on Earnings Per Share [Line Items]
|Total investment in securities at fair value
|$ 78,789,799
|$ 82,645,469
|Total investment in securities at fair value
|50,691,684
|36,337,023
|Investment securities - fair value NAV as practial expedient
|100,000
|Total investment in securities at fair value
|50,791,684
|American Premium Water Corp [Member]
|Impairment Effects on Earnings Per Share [Line Items]
|Total investment in securities at fair value
|815,514
|1,009,854
|Fair Value, Inputs, Level 1 [Member]
|Impairment Effects on Earnings Per Share [Line Items]
|Total investment in securities at fair value
|49,786,895
|35,228,771
|Fair Value, Inputs, Level 2 [Member]
|Impairment Effects on Earnings Per Share [Line Items]
|Total investment in securities at fair value
|Fair Value, Inputs, Level 3 [Member]
|Impairment Effects on Earnings Per Share [Line Items]
|Total investment in securities at fair value
|904,789
|1,108,252
|Investment Securities Fair Value [Member]
|Impairment Effects on Earnings Per Share [Line Items]
|Total investment in securities at fair value
|76,264,051
|72,000,301
|Total investment in securities at fair value
|47,389,726
|25,320,694
|Investment Securities Fair Value [Member] | Fair Value, Inputs, Level 1 [Member]
|Impairment Effects on Earnings Per Share [Line Items]
|Total investment in securities at fair value
|47,389,726
|25,320,694
|Investment Securities Fair Value [Member] | Fair Value, Inputs, Level 2 [Member]
|Impairment Effects on Earnings Per Share [Line Items]
|Total investment in securities at fair value
|Investment Securities Fair Value [Member] | Fair Value, Inputs, Level 3 [Member]
|Impairment Effects on Earnings Per Share [Line Items]
|Total investment in securities at fair value
|Investments Securities Trading [Member]
|Impairment Effects on Earnings Per Share [Line Items]
|Total investment in securities at fair value
|2,387,149
|9,809,778
|Total investment in securities at fair value
|2,397,169
|9,908,077
|Investments Securities Trading [Member] | Fair Value, Inputs, Level 1 [Member]
|Impairment Effects on Earnings Per Share [Line Items]
|Total investment in securities at fair value
|2,397,169
|9,908,077
|Investments Securities Trading [Member] | Fair Value, Inputs, Level 2 [Member]
|Impairment Effects on Earnings Per Share [Line Items]
|Total investment in securities at fair value
|Investments Securities Trading [Member] | Fair Value, Inputs, Level 3 [Member]
|Impairment Effects on Earnings Per Share [Line Items]
|Total investment in securities at fair value
|Notes Receivable [Member]
|Impairment Effects on Earnings Per Share [Line Items]
|Total investment in securities at fair value
|138,599
|138,599
|Total investment in securities at fair value
|89,275
|98,398
|Notes Receivable [Member] | Fair Value, Inputs, Level 1 [Member]
|Impairment Effects on Earnings Per Share [Line Items]
|Total investment in securities at fair value
|Notes Receivable [Member] | Fair Value, Inputs, Level 2 [Member]
|Impairment Effects on Earnings Per Share [Line Items]
|Total investment in securities at fair value
|Notes Receivable [Member] | Fair Value, Inputs, Level 3 [Member]
|Impairment Effects on Earnings Per Share [Line Items]
|Total investment in securities at fair value
|89,275
|98,398
|Warrant [Member] | American Premium Water Corp [Member]
|Impairment Effects on Earnings Per Share [Line Items]
|Total investment in securities at fair value
|696,791
|Total investment in securities at fair value
|815,514
|1,009,854
|Warrant [Member] | American Medical REIT Inc [Member]
|Impairment Effects on Earnings Per Share [Line Items]
|Total investment in securities at fair value
|Total investment in securities at fair value
|Warrant [Member] | Fair Value, Inputs, Level 1 [Member] | American Premium Water Corp [Member]
|Impairment Effects on Earnings Per Share [Line Items]
|Total investment in securities at fair value
|Warrant [Member] | Fair Value, Inputs, Level 1 [Member] | American Medical REIT Inc [Member]
|Impairment Effects on Earnings Per Share [Line Items]
|Total investment in securities at fair value
|Warrant [Member] | Fair Value, Inputs, Level 2 [Member] | American Premium Water Corp [Member]
|Impairment Effects on Earnings Per Share [Line Items]
|Total investment in securities at fair value
|Warrant [Member] | Fair Value, Inputs, Level 2 [Member] | American Medical REIT Inc [Member]
|Impairment Effects on Earnings Per Share [Line Items]
|Total investment in securities at fair value
|Warrant [Member] | Fair Value, Inputs, Level 3 [Member] | American Premium Water Corp [Member]
|Impairment Effects on Earnings Per Share [Line Items]
|Total investment in securities at fair value
|815,514
|1,009,854
|Warrant [Member] | Fair Value, Inputs, Level 3 [Member] | American Medical REIT Inc [Member]
|Impairment Effects on Earnings Per Share [Line Items]
|Total investment in securities at fair value
|X
- Definition
+ References
Investment at fair value.
+ Details
No definition available.
|X
- Definition
+ References
Investments securities fair value disclosure.
+ Details
No definition available.
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Definition
+ References
Sum of the carrying amounts as of the balance sheet date of all investments.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Fair value portion of investment securities, including, but not limited to, marketable securities, derivative financial instruments, and investments accounted for under the equity method.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details